Short answer: the JBL Pulse 5. It ranks #42 of 134 medium speakers at $199.99; the Turtlebox Ranger ranks #53 and costs $250, so there is not much of a tradeoff to weigh.

What the JBL Pulse 5 gets right: Cool light show, although not synced to the music like the Pulse 2. The tradeoff: Not quite as deep bass as others.

On the Turtlebox Ranger side: Much better frequency response than the other Turtlebox speakers. The tradeoff: Bass sounds kind of thuddy and isn’t as deep as higher ranked speakers.

Buy the JBL Pulse 5 if the ranking matters more than the price. Buy the Turtlebox Ranger if the price matters more than the ranking.

Pros: Cool light show, although not synced to the music like the Pulse 2.

Cons: Not quite as deep bass as others. Plastic scratches easily.

Pros: Much better frequency response than the other Turtlebox speakers. Has magnets for attaching it to things. Appears to be quite tough

Cons: Bass sounds kind of thuddy and isn’t as deep as higher ranked speakers. Overpriced. Heavy for the size, likely due to the toughness
